Is Crispy Chicken Tender Salad Good for You?

There are two main things that can help keep this chicken tender salad in the “healthy” category: the type of chicken tenders you purchase and how much and what type of dressing you use.

Eating a non-fried chicken salad is always the healthiest choice that unfortunately can get repetitive.

And while chicken is a great protein option that is lean in fat with minimal carbs, breaded chicken tenders are not always made equal. For this reason, check the label and ingredients of the ones you purchase if not making your own.

And since this salad has lots of texture and flavor, you don’t need to drench it in dressing to make it taste great.

Crispy Chicken Tender Salad Ingredients

You’ll find that the salad ingredients listed below are simple and easy to find – which is my favorite type of ingredient list!

  • breaded chicken strips: you can get these already breaded at the store or bake your own breaded chicken strips (see recipe below).
  • Romaine or green lettuce: cleaned and chopped up.
  • grape tomatoes: perfect for halving and adding to the salad mix. Cherry tomatoes will work as well.
  • avocado: dice it up and remove the pit.
  • red onion: slice it then and add it to the salad with the rest of the ingredients.
  • Ranch dressing: just a drizzle, to finish. Store-bought or homemade Greek yogurt ranch is what I recommend.

How to Make Salad with Chicken Tenders

Making a salad means that you have options! Mix and match in veggies, and you’ll create a new salad flavor every time.

Follow the directions below to create the perfect chicken salad.

  1. Preheat the oven
    Preheat the oven to 400F and line a large ba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Bake the chicken
    Bake chicken tenders for a total of 25 to 30 minutes, making sure to flip halfway through.
  3. Prepare the salad
    Meanwhile, prepare the salad bowls by layering the lettuce, tomatoes, avocado, and red onion.
  4. Slice the chicken
    Once the tenders are ready, remove them from the oven and slice the strips diagonally on a cutting board.
  5. Top the salad
    Top each salad bowl with breaded chicken and drizzle Ranch dressing over the top.

Crispy Chicken Tender Salad

Servings: 4
Prep Time: 10 minutes mins
Cook Time: 20 minutes mins
Total Time: 30 minutes mins
This Crispy Chicken Tender Salad is a fun and flavorful way to make a delicious salad recipe right at home! 
5 from 25 votes
Print Pin

Watch how it’s made:

Ingredients

  • 8 breaded chicken strips
  • 1 head Romaine or green lettuce, chopped
  • 1 cup grape tomatoes, halved
  • 1 avocado, pitted and diced
  • 1 small red onion, sliced thin
  • Ranch dressing

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 400F and line a large baking sheet with parchment paper.
  • Bake chicken tenders for a total of 25 to 30 minutes, making sure to flip halfway through.
  • Meanwhile, prepare the salad bowls by layering the lettuce, tomatoes, avocado, and red onion.
  • Once the tenders are ready, remove them from the oven and slice the strips diagonally on a cutting board.
  • Top each salad bowl with breaded chicken and drizzle Ranch dressing over the top.
